I have a couple colonies of this coral that I got from a friend who had forgotten what it was. Grows quickly, and has shown up as "spontaneous" colonies in a few places in the tank. Because of this, I am leaning towards it being a Pocillipora (planula propogation). The colony on the right was recently broken, and the white is the interior of the colony with clear polyps. Does anyone have a definitive species ID they can give me here?
